A pool is a great way to improve a backyard, but, let’s be honest, nobody builds a pool just to look at it. Pools are meant for swimming and to have fun in – the perfect environment for kids. However, these days kids would rather play Pokémon Go than go swimming. If you have a pool and feel like your kids aren’t using it to its full extent, then check out the tips below on how to get your kids in the pool.

Weekly Pool Parties

The pool party can be for just your family or with other kids from around the neighborhood; regardless, a pool party is a great way to get the most out of your pool. It doesn’t have to be anything big and elaborate, rather just mark a date on the calendar and plan a small party. Simply invite some people, grill up some food, and turn on some music and you have yourself a pool party that will surely encourage your kids to jump in.

Swim Lessons

This one’s for younger kids, but swim lessons are a great way to get your kid swimming and loving pools. Swim lessons can be in your pool or at a separate location. Pool Toys and Games

Pool toys and games are two great ways to get your kids to play in the pool. Toys can range from floaties to basketball hoops and simple games like Marco Polo can even be exciting. Underwater Photos

There are various ways to take underwater photos whether it be with a GoPro, Lifeproof case, or cheap underwater camera. Underwater pictures can turn out to be super cool and kids are sure to love them, whether they want to post the pics on their Facebook, Instagram, or simply just look at the photos.
